Understanding Self-Emptying Robot Vacuums
Self-emptying Robot Vacuum With Self Emptying vacuums are created to simplify the cleaning process even further. These machines not only navigate around your home to tidy floorings but also automatically move the dust and particles they collect into a bigger base station. The procedure is smooth, and users are frequently relieved of the trouble of by hand emptying the vacuum after every cleaning session.

How frequently do I need to empty the base station?
The frequency of emptying the base station differs depending on the design and usage. Some models can go weeks without needing an empty, while others might need attention every couple of weeks.
2. Can self-emptying robot vacuums tidy carpets successfully?
Yes, many self-emptying robot vacuums are designed to clean different surfaces, including carpets. Designs with adjustable suction power can automatically increase suction when transitioning from difficult floorings to carpets.
3. Do I need to be home for the vacuum to function?
No, self-emptying robot vacuums can work individually. They can be arranged to operate while you're away, and their smart navigation permits them to avoid challenges and charge as needed.
4. Are self-emptying robot vacuums loud?
Most self-emptying robot vacuums have a moderate sound level during operation. Nevertheless, this can differ by design, so it's recommended to check user evaluations for sound level assessments.
5. Are these vacuums ideal for homes with family pets?
Yes, most self-emptying vacuum designs are designed to manage pet hair and dander. Many come geared up with powerful suction and specifically designed brushes to lift family pet hair from various surfaces.
